# Optimizing Chelsea's Tactical Training: Building Cohesive Performance in a Star-Studded Squad **Introduction** Chelsea FC, with its star-studded squad, is widely regarded as one of the most formidable teams in world football. However, the pressure to deliver consistent performances, especially in high-stakes matches, demands meticulous tactical preparation. This article explores how Chelsea can optimize its tactical training to foster cohesive performance, ensuring that individual brilliance translates into collective success. **Building a Strong Team Identity** At the heart of cohesive performance lies a shared identity. Chelsea’s tactical training should emphasize the importance of individual roles and collective responsibilities. Players must understand their roles within the system, from the defensive anchor to the attacking pivot. By fostering a sense of belonging, Chelsea can create a unified front that thrives on teamwork and mutual respect. **Adapting Tactical Systems to the Squad** Chelsea’s squad is a mix of world-class talents, each with unique abilities. Tactical training must adapt to this diversity, ensuring that the system accommodates different playing styles. For instance, Chelsea’s defensive stability is a cornerstone of its success, but offensive fluidity must also be encouraged, especially with players like Kai Havertz and Mason Mount who excel in transition. **Enhancing Communication and Coordination** Effective communication is the backbone of cohesive performance. Chelsea’s training should prioritize verbal and non-verbal cues, ensuring that players are on the same page. Drills that simulate real-time decision-making, like quick free-kicks or counter-attacks, help build trust and coordination. Additionally, video analysis can be used to breakdown opponents and refine strategies. **培养适应性和灵活性** In a star-studded squad, not every player will perform optimally in every match. Chelsea’s tactical training should focus on adaptability, allowing players to shift positions and strategies based on the game’s dynamics. This flexibility is crucial, especially when facing tenacious opponents or when key players face fatigue. **Conclusion** Optimizing Chelsea’s tactical training is about creating a cohesive unit where individual talents complement each other. By building a strong team identity, adapting systems to the squad’s strengths, enhancing communication, and fostering adaptability, Chelsea can unlock the full potential of its star-studded squad. With cohesive performance, the Blues can dominate not just in England but on the global stage, cementing their legacy as a football powerhouse. |
